Transaction 65abf4fc7c545dc41e01763764607f28d606b1e24d766f2f48345f48d5a49176
2 Input
2 Outputs
- 65abf4fc7c545dc41e01763764607f28d606b1e24d766f2f48345f48d5a49176:0
- 65abf4fc7c545dc41e01763764607f28d606b1e24d766f2f48345f48d5a49176:1
value 8757900
address 1KQRMbrPpCZzdECFVLSVAvhvjMnpe3zitS
value 329623
address 3AsuyK89dxJe53rYYxDgqfLN9PRgTLeJbW